Overview

Glehnia Alcohol Free contains Glehnia littoralis root extract, an herb traditionally used in medicine. While preclinical studies suggest potential health benefits, there's limited clinical evidence to confirm its effectiveness in humans. More research is needed to determine the extent of its benefits.
